This week Mr. Collins' 9th grade social studies classes concluded their month-long stock market activity. Students simulated making investments using stocks and/or crypto currency. Students were allotted an initial balance of $10,000 for the activity. They were required to keep a minimum of five percent of their initial balance in reserve and had to pay a three percent brokerage fee for each of their buy/sell transactions. Students tracked their investments over the course of four weeks and simulated a sale of assets on the final day to complete the project which included a twelve percent deduction to simulate federal taxes on realized short term capital gains. Mr. Eric Wells, member of the MVBT board of education and VP of the Liberty Branch of West Plains Bank and Trust Company, Mrs. Lindsay Holden, Assistant VP, and Kerri Vermillion of West Plains Bank presented our winners with gift cards for their accomplishments. The top three earners, and their net gains are: 3rd Place Ty Roby $167.27 2nd Place Marianne Dewick $328.10 1st Place Evan Cope $542.66

After the election was certified, Gaylon Noble emerged as the winner, leaving a tie between Dr. Jennifer Foster and Mike Smith. The tied candidates agreed to forego a special election, agreeing to toss a coin to break the tie. (A special election would have cost the district a significant amount of money. Neither candidate wanted to place that financial burden on the district.) We had originally planned to toss the coin at our next board meeting, but due to unexpected circumstances we had to move our coin toss to this evening. Vice President Eric Wells tossed a coin. Mike Smith won the coin toss. At our upcoming board meeting next Tuesday night, we will be reorganizing the board, welcoming Gaylon Noble and Mike Smith into their new roles. Dr. Jennifer Foster has served on the board since 2015. Her dedication and leadership have been invaluable to our community. We extend our heartfelt gratitude for her service.
